Vangi bhat(eggplant rice)
Ingredient
Food ration :
serves 4 servin
Cooking time :
40 minutes
Cooking instructions
* Step 1
Soak rice in water for 30 minutes.dry roast peanuts and sesame seeds separately.blend them together to make fine powder.
* Step 2
Ghati masala is preparation usually done in summer season.it is mixture of dry Red chilly and all garam masala (cloves, cinnamon, bay leaf, black pepper etc.) Blended with roasted onion.
* Step 3
Ghati masala is important in this dish.now in bowl take peanuts and sesame seeds powder,add turmeric powder, Red chilly powder,salt,ghati masala.mix well,stuff masala in eggplant to the fullest.
* Step 4
Now take deep pan add oil to it, add cumin seeds.add sliced onions to this saute.add turmeric powder and remaining mixture of masala in rice
* Step 5
Mix well add sufficient water to it allow it to cook. Once 60 percent rice is done put eggplants upside-down in rice.
* Step 6
Cook for 20 minutes on low flame, eggplant and rice should be cooked properly.it may take ten more minutes.
* Step 7
Once it is cooked properly. Serve hot.it is always paired with dahi raita as it's spicy preparation.but it tastes yum.usually it is prepared after festival to change taste.hot spicy rice with cool raita is heavenly combination.do try this.
